Why These Are the Top Lexus Repair Auto Repair Shops in Wyola

The Lexus repair market for residents of Wyola, MT, is virtually non-existent locally and is entirely dependent on service centers in Billings. The market in Billings is moderately competitive with a clear tiered structure. **Lexus of Billings** holds the top position as the authorized dealer, commanding premium pricing for factory-certified work and warranty services. Independent specialists like **The Import Mechanics** and **T & T Auto Service** offer a high-quality, often more personalized and cost-effective alternative for out-of-warranty vehicles and specific complex repairs. Typical pricing reflects this structure, with dealership labor rates being the highest, followed by the specialized independents. For a Wyola resident, the primary consideration is the 150-mile journey, making it essential to schedule multi-point services or complex repairs efficiently. All three providers listed are accustomed to serving customers from a wide geographical area and are the most realistic options for expert Lexus care.

Are Lexus repair services more expensive in Wyola, Montana, compared to larger cities?

Yes, specialized Lexus repair in a rural area like Wyola can sometimes carry a premium due to the need to source specific parts and the limited number of technicians with brand expertise. However, local independent shops may offer more competitive labor rates than dealerships in Billings, though you should factor in potential travel for complex services.

What are the most common Lexus repair issues for vehicles driven on Wyola's rural roads and in Montana winters?

Suspension components, such as control arms and struts, often wear faster due to rough, unpaved roads common in the area. Additionally, the cold climate can stress batteries and lead to issues with the all-wheel-drive system, which is crucial for winter traction on highways like I-90.

When should I seek local service versus taking my Lexus to a dealership in Billings?

For routine maintenance, oil changes, brake work, and tire service, a qualified local shop in Wyola or nearby Crow Agency is sufficient. For major warranty work, complex hybrid system issues, or advanced electronic diagnostics, the authorized Lexus dealership in Billings (approx. 70 miles away) is the necessary destination.

How can I find a quality, trustworthy repair shop for my Lexus near Wyola?

Seek shops in nearby communities like Hardin or Crow Agency that explicitly list experience with luxury brands or Toyota/Lexus specifically. Look for ASE-certified technicians and ask directly about their diagnostic tool capabilities for Lexus models, as proper software is critical for accurate repairs.

What local considerations should I keep in mind for Lexus maintenance in this area?

Given the long distances between services, strict adherence to your maintenance schedule is vital. Prioritize seasonal tire changes and undercarriage inspections for rust prevention due to winter road treatments. Always plan ahead for repairs, as obtaining specialized Lexus parts can add days to the service timeline in rural Montana.
